On Feb. 22, The Official Wilco Reverb Shop will launch. The online store will give fans, followers and music enthusiasts the unique opportunity to purchase a piece of the band’s history as they make room for new pieces by weeding out the old and listing them for sale. 

Among the rare gear, touring instruments and recording equipment that will be available for purchase is a century-old Burdett pump organ, which the band’s studio manager, Mark Greenberg, reveres as a staple of the space.

According to Greenberg, “Though we love it, it takes up a pretty large footprint, and in the name of freeing up space, we are ready to let this go. If you love something, set it free, right?”  

Along with the organ, the shop will also include two Avalon AD2022 rack preamps that the group’s frontman, Jeff Tweedy, has taken on the road and paired with acoustic guitars for the last 15 years. 

Other items include Nels Cline’s Carr Impala combo amplifier, a rare Standel Custom Electric Guitar, a 1963 Gibson Everly Bros acoustic and a Martin 0-18k, which was constructed in 1933.
